How Postbox Protects User Passwords

Postbox employs a multi-layered security architecture to safeguard user passwords . This approach includes encryption protocols that transform plaintext passwords into unreadable formats. Consequently, even if unauthorized access occurs, the actual passwords remain protected. Security is paramount in today’s digital landscape.

Additionally, Postbox utilizes hashing algorithms, which further enhance password security. These algorithms create a unique hash for each password, making it nearly impossible to reverse-engineer the original password. This method significantly reduces the risk of data breaches. It’s a smart strategy.

Moreover, Postbox implements 2-factor authentication (2FA) as an added layer of protectiln. By requiring a second form of verification, such as a code sent to a mobile device, it ensures that only authorized users can access their accounts. This practice is becoming increasingly common.

Furthermore, regular security audits and updates are conducted to identify and mitigate potential vulnerabilities. This proactive approach helps maintain the integrity of the system. Staying ahead of threats is crucial.

In summary, Postbox’s comprehensive security mechanisms work together to protect user passwords effectively. Each layer of security contributes to a robust defense against unauthorized access. Security should never be taken lightly.
